Position Overview
We are seeking a dedicated and compassionate Physical Therapist Assistant (PTA) to join our team in both full-time and per diem capacities. The ideal candidate works effectively under the supervision of a licensed Physical Therapist and is committed to helping patients achieve their rehabilitation goals.
Responsibilities
- Provide physical therapy treatments and interventions as directed by the supervising Physical Therapist
- Assist in implementing individualized treatment plans to improve strength, mobility, balance, and function
- Monitor patient progress and communicate updates or concerns to the Physical Therapist
- Instruct patients in therapeutic exercises and functional mobility activities
- Maintain accurate and timely documentation in compliance with regulatory standards
- Ensure a safe and clean therapy environment
- Collaborate with interdisciplinary team members to support optimal patient outcomes
Qualifications
- Associate degree from an accredited Physical Therapist Assistant program
- Current Texas PTA license (or eligibility)
- Strong communication and interpersonal skills
- Ability to work effectively under the supervision of a Physical Therapist
- Experience in rehabilitation, skilled nursing, or outpatient settings preferred
